Plumtree Town Council to enforce dog laws

Kudzai Gaveni, Online Writer

THE PLUMTREE Town Council will be enforcing dog licensing laws with effect from 20 March 2024.

In a statement, Plumtree Acting Town Secretary Thembalami

Nyoni said the enforcement exercise will entail checking for dog licenses/permits, breeding certificates/licenses, the number of dogs within a property, and the destruction of stray and unsecured dogs.

“To avoid inconveniences owners should obtain licenses, and secure their animals within their property boundaries,” reads the statement.
